Sean Pettinger

RINK Winnipeg - Player Development Head Coach

Sean began his hockey career with the Swan Valley Stampeders of the Manitoba Junior Hockey League (MJHL) in 2002. He played with the club for four years before accepting a hockey scholarship to the University of Wisconsin-River Falls. In River Falls, Sean played for four years before graduating with honours with a Bachelor of Science degree. He then moved back to Winnipeg to attend the University of Manitoba where he pursued an Education degree while playing for Manitoba’s Allan Cup team; The Southeast Prairie Thunder.

Upon moving back to Winnipeg, Sean has been extensively involved in developing players as a member if The Rink Team. Sean’s experience in coaching doesn’t stop there, as he has also spent time coaching spring hockey with various teams as well as having experience as an instructor at the Impact Hockey School in Brandon, Manitoba. Currently, Sean is a teacher at Starbuck School and is involved in their hockey academy as well.
